What is a Splash Page?
A Splash Page is an intermediate page shown before the visitor reaches the final destination. Think of it as a short advertising or announcement screen placed in front of your Klik VIP link.
For example, a visitor clicks your Biolink or Shortened Link. Instead of going directly to the destination, Klik VIP can first show the Splash Page for a few seconds. The visitor can then continue manually, or Klik VIP can automatically redirect them when the countdown ends.

1. Create the Basic Splash Page
Open Splash Pages in Klik VIP and choose Create a new splash page. Start with the main content your visitors will see.
- Name — an internal label to help you identify the Splash Page later.
- Logo — optionally upload a logo or campaign image.
- Title — the main headline visitors will read first.
- Description — supporting copy, promo text or an explanation.

4. Assign the Splash Page to a Klik VIP Link
Creating the Splash Page does not automatically attach it to every link. Open the Klik VIP link you want to use, find the Splash page option, and select the Splash Page from the dropdown.
The screenshot below shows the option inside a Biolink. Klik VIP can also use Splash Pages with other supported link types, such as Shortened Links.
- Open the link you want to edit.
- Find the Splash page setting.
- Select the Splash Page you created.
- Click Update to save the link.
